Types of Iron Pipes


Iron pipes come in several different types, each suited for specific purposes. The main types include:


1. Cast Iron Pipes


Cast iron pipes have been used for plumbing and drainage systems for over a century. They are known for their durability and resistance to corrosion. These pipes are commonly found in older homes and buildings and are still used in certain applications today due to their ability to withstand high pressure and extreme conditions.

  • Key Features: Strong, corrosion-resistant, and long-lasting.

  • Common Applications: Sewer systems, drainage, and waste disposal in buildings.



2. Ductile Iron Pipes


Ductile iron pipes are an advanced version of cast iron pipes. They are more flexible and durable, making them a preferred choice in modern construction and infrastructure projects. Ductile iron is made by adding magnesium to cast iron, which improves its flexibility and impact resistance.

  • Key Features: High strength, flexibility, and resistance to cracking.

  • Common Applications: Water supply lines, wastewater treatment plants, and gas pipelines.



3. Wrought Iron Pipes


Wrought iron pipes are less commonly used today but were once popular in construction and plumbing. They are made by heating and working iron to produce a strong, malleable material. Wrought iron pipes are resistant to corrosion and rust, which makes them ideal for outdoor use.

  • Key Features: Durable, rust-resistant, and easily shaped.

  • Common Applications: Fencing, railings, and decorative architecture.



4. Galvanized Iron Pipes


Galvanized iron pipes are coated with a layer of zinc to prevent corrosion. This makes them suitable for use in water supply systems, especially in environments where the pipes are exposed to moisture. However, galvanized pipes are prone to corrosion over time, which can lead to water contamination, so they are less commonly used in new construction projects.

  • Key Features: Corrosion-resistant, affordable, and durable.

  • Common Applications: Water supply lines, outdoor plumbing, and irrigation systems.



5. Malleable Iron Pipes


Malleable iron pipes are made by heating white cast iron and then cooling it slowly to form a more flexible and ductile material. This process allows malleable iron pipes to be bent and shaped without breaking, making them ideal for use in applications that require flexibility and impact resistance.

  • Key Features: Flexible, strong, and resistant to cracking.

  • Common Applications: Gas lines, fittings, and industrial machinery.



Uses of Iron Pipes


Iron pipes are used in a wide range of industries due to their strength, durability, and ability to withstand pressure and harsh conditions. Here are some common uses of iron pipes:


1. Water Supply Systems


Iron pipes, particularly ductile and galvanized iron, are widely used in water distribution systems. Their corrosion resistance and strength make them ideal for transporting water over long distances and in various environments. Ductile iron pipes are commonly used in municipal water supply systems, while galvanized iron pipes are often found in residential plumbing.


2. Sewer and Drainage Systems


Cast iron pipes have been the standard for sewer and drainage systems for many years. Their durability and ability to withstand high pressure make them suitable for transporting wastewater and sewage. Cast iron’s resistance to corrosion also makes it an excellent choice for underground sewer lines.


3. Gas Pipelines


Malleable and ductile iron pipes are often used in gas pipelines due to their flexibility and ability to withstand high pressure. These pipes can handle the demands of transporting natural gas and other fuels over long distances without cracking or breaking.


4. Industrial Applications


Iron pipes are frequently used in industrial settings, where their strength and resistance to extreme temperatures and pressure are critical. Ductile iron and malleable iron pipes are commonly used in factories, power plants, and manufacturing facilities for transporting gases, liquids, and chemicals.


5. Construction


Wrought iron pipes are used in construction for their strength and aesthetic appeal. They are commonly used in architectural features such as fencing, railings, and gates, as well as in structural support for buildings and bridges.


6. Fire Protection Systems


Iron pipes, particularly ductile iron, are used in fire protection systems due to their ability to withstand high pressure and extreme heat. They are used in sprinkler systems, fire hydrants, and other fire suppression equipment.


Factors That Affect Iron Pipe Prices


The prices of iron pipes can vary depending on several factors, including the type of pipe, the raw materials used, and market demand. Here are the main factors that influence iron pipe prices:


1. Raw Material Costs


The cost of iron ore and other raw materials used in the production of iron pipes has a significant impact on their prices. When the cost of raw materials rises, the price of iron pipes typically increases as well.


2. Manufacturing Process


The process used to manufacture iron pipes also affects their price. For example, ductile iron pipes, which undergo a more complex manufacturing process than cast iron pipes, are typically more expensive due to the additional materials and labor required.


3. Market Demand


Demand for iron pipes in industries like construction, plumbing, and manufacturing can drive prices up. When demand is high, prices may increase, especially in regions experiencing a construction boom or infrastructure expansion.


4. Transportation and Distribution Costs


The cost of transporting heavy iron pipes from manufacturing plants to construction sites or distributors can also impact the final price. Shipping costs can vary depending on the distance and the size of the pipes being transported.


5. Government Regulations and Taxes


Tariffs, taxes, and government regulations on the production and import of iron pipes can also affect prices. For instance, import duties on foreign-made iron pipes may lead to higher prices for consumers in certain countries.
